Part Overview

The XRCWHT-L1-0000-00610 is a CreeLED XLamp® XR-C cool white surface mount LED in 3529 (9073 Metric) package configuration. This part is classified as obsolete, making substitute parts necessary for ongoing production and design updates. The XLamp® XR-C series has been superseded by the XLamp® XR-E series, which maintains electrical and mechanical compatibility while offering improved thermal performance and extended product lifecycle support.

Key Parameters

Parameter Value
Manufacturer Part Number XRCWHT-L1-0000-00610
Manufacturer CreeLED, Inc.
Series XLamp® XR-C
Product Status Obsolete
Color White
Flux @ 25°C, 350mA 65 lm (62–67 lm range)
Forward Voltage (Vf) Typical 4.6V
Test Current 350 mA
Maximum Current 500 mA
Lumens per Watt @ 350mA 53 lm/W
Viewing Angle 90°
Package / Case 3529 (9073 Metric)
Mounting Type Surface Mount
Size / Dimension 0.354" L × 0.276" W (9.00 mm × 7.00 mm)
Height - Seated (Max) 0.181" (4.60 mm)
Thermal Resistance 12°C/W
RoHS Status RoHS Compliant
Moisture Sensitivity Level (MSL) 4 (72 Hours)
REACH Status REACH Unaffected
